The band's second studio album will be released on September 28, 2010. The sophomore effort will not only continue with the Dance-pop/Electronica style but will also incoporate a Reggae sound. Gomez said in an interview with Z100 New York that it will feature some songs that did not make it onto the first album and that the rest of the band will be much more included on it. When asked about plans for a new single the frontwoman said:
"I think we might go right into the second album so it might be something completely different. Hopefully we'll get the next single out before the summer because [we] have a new song that's just a really fun summer song and I want it out really soon!" The record's first single, "Round & Round", premiered on June 18, 2010. The accompanying music video, which was filmed in Budapest, premiered two days later. The single debuted at number 24 on Billboard's Hot 100, and 76 on the Canadian Hot 100. It also debuted at number 15 on Billboard's Digital Songs chart. The Scene is set to promote the album through mostly television appearances. They will appear on shows such as Late Show with David Letterman as well as the Today Show, among others.
On Tuesday, July 6th, MTV confirmed that the album will be titled A Year Without Rain.

In a recent interview with MTV, Gomez stated that the working album title is A Year Without Rain. "It's kind of got a more feel-good dance beat and feel," she said. "It's different, kind of shows my growth [in] music. I think if anything the lyrics are more powerful, in a way." In addition to the lead single "Round & Round" the album will feature a song called "Intuition" and the title track "A Year Without Rain". ] In the Z100 interview, Gomez said that there will be a song called "Rock God" which Katy Perry gave her and will be doing background vocals.
